Aerospaziale

The aerospace industry stands out as one of the biggest adopters of 3D printing technology. The need for lightweight, strong, and complex parts in aircraft and spacecraft makes 3D printing an ideal solution. Manufacturers can use this technology to produce intricate engine components, fuel nozzles, and even entire aircraft sections with unparalleled precision and efficiency. The ability to print parts on-demand also reduces inventory costs and lead times, making 3D printing an invaluable tool in the aerospace industry.

Medical

The medical industry is another sector that has embraced 3D printing with open arms. From customized prosthetics and implants to surgical guides and models, 3D printing is revolutionizing the way healthcare professionals treat patients. The ability to create patient-specific solutions on-demand enables doctors and surgeons to provide more personalized and effective care. Inoltre, 3D printing can be used to produce complex anatomical models for educational purposes and surgical planning.

Automobile

The automotive industry is also a significant user of 3D printing technology. Manufacturers leverage this technology to produce prototypes, utensili, and even end-use parts. The ability to quickly iterate on designs and produce complex geometries makes 3D printing an essential tool in the automotive sector. Inoltre, 3D printing can be used to produce lightweight components that improve fuel efficiency and reduce emissions.

Altre industrie

While the aerospace, medico, and automotive industries are among the biggest adopters of 3D printing, other sectors are also starting to see the benefits of this technology. Per esempio, the consumer goods industry is using 3D printing to produce customized products and prototypes, while the defense industry is leveraging it to create lightweight and durable parts for military equipment.

Factors Influencing Adoption

The widespread adoption of 3D printing in these industries is driven by several factors. The ability to produce complex, customized parts on-demand is a major selling point. Inoltre, 3D printing can reduce lead times, minimize waste, and lower production costs compared to traditional manufacturing methods.
